Coasts & Canyons

Mexico, 15 Nights

Day 1 - London/Mexico City
Departure from London Heathrow with British Airways to Mexico City. Arrival transfer to The Four Seasons Hotel for two nights.

Day 2 - Mexico City
Morning visit to the astonishing archaeological zone of Teotihuacan. Afternoon guided tour of Mexico City's historic centre.

Day 3 - Mexico City/El Fuerte
Fly to Los Mochis. Transfer by road to El Fuerte, the delightful colonial gateway to the Copper Canyon. Afternoon walk to view the pre-Columbian petroglyphs along the banks of the El Fuerte River and visit the small museum highlighting the era of the outlaw Pancho Villa. Overnight at Torres del Fuerte Hotel.

Day 4 - El Fuerte/Cerocahui
An early wake-up call for the private transfer to the station for the legendary Chihuahua-Pacifico train. The journey will take you from cactus to cedar and from rolling foothills to dramatic canyons. Arrive at Bahuichivo Station before midday. Shared van journey to the traditional village of Cerocahui, founded by Jesuit missionaries in 1694. Overnight at the Hotel Mision.

Day 5 - Cerocahui/Posada Barrancas

Morning group walk or horse ride to the Cerocahui Waterfall, known locally as Hulcochi, which in the Tarahumara language means 'place of many trees'. Just after midday, board the train to continue the journey up into the Sierra Madre Mountains to Posada Barrancas Station at 2,200 metres above sea level. Short 'shuttle' service to the Mirador Hotel, poised like an eagle's nest on the edge of the canyon. Afternoon at leisure. Enjoy one night at the traditional hotel, affording excellent views of the canyon.

Day 6 - Posada Barrancas/Creel
Depart on another spectacular journey, this time by road with a private driver to the frontier town of Creel. Time at leisure before continuing on via Lake Arareko, to Sierra Mountain Lodge for one night. 

Day 7 - Creel/Batopilas
After breakfast start an incredible road journey of rugged switchbacks, passing through the Copper and La Bufa Canyons, descending to Batopilas - an incredible town 'lost in time'. Two nights at Casa Real de Minas, a renovated turn of the century mansion.

Day 8 - Batopilas
Day at leisure to soak in the history of Batopilas, laze by the river, enjoy a beer with the locals in the Singing Bridge Bar or visit 'The Lost Cathedral of Satevo'.

Day 9 - Batopilas/El Fuerte
Morning return back up the road to Creel (helicopter or private plane transfer optional extra) to join the train on its return journey to El Fuerte. Late evening arrival and transfer to the Torres del Fuerte Hotel for a one-night stay.

Day 10 - El Fuerte/Los Cabos
Transfer to Los Mochis for the shared charter flight to San Jose del Cabo. Enjoy five nights at the exclusive Las Ventanas Rosewood Resort.

Days 11 to 14 - Los Cabos
Relax and unwind at this beautiful hotel with its excellent spa, network of pools and exceptional dining options. Option to do a full day whale watching trip November to February.

Day 15 - Los Cabos/London
Midday flight to Mexico City to connect with the British Airways flight to London Heathrow. Arrive day 16.
